Tirhatuan Ward

Highest level of schooling

In Tirhatuan Ward, 57.6% of people aged over 15 years had completed Year 12 schooling (or equivalent) as of 2016. This was greater than Baird Ward.

Tirhatuan Ward's school completion data is a useful indicator of socio-economic status. With other indicators, such as Proficiency in English, the data informs planners and decision-makers about people's ability to access services. Combined with Educational Qualifications it also allows assessment of the skill base of the population.

Dominant groups

Analysis of the highest level of schooling attained by the population in Tirhatuan Ward in 2016 compared to Baird Ward shows that there was a lower proportion of people who had left school at an early level (Year 10 or less) and a higher proportion of people who completed Year 12 or equivalent.

Overall, 25.4% of the population left school at Year 10 or below, and 57.6% went on to complete Year 12 or equivalent, compared with 28.9% and 51.3% respectively for Baird Ward.

The major differences between the level of schooling attained by the population in Tirhatuan Ward and Baird Ward were:

  • A larger percentage of persons who completed year 12 or equivalent (57.6% compared to 51.3%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ons who completed year 10 or equivalent (14.1% compared to 16.5%)

Emerging groups

The largest changes in the level of schooling attained by the population in Tirhatuan Ward, between 2006 and 2016 were:

  • Year 12 or equivalent (+1,876 persons)
  • Year 11 or equivalent (-351 persons)
  • Year 10 or equivalent (-220 persons)
  • Year 9 or equivalent (-113 persons)
